Output 59af8c7d5569b44772048832b4373a3eb9847b9d133207fc15f690cf3b4bc36a:1

value
586292271
script pubkey
OP_0 OP_PUSHBYTES_20 df09f87607a38ba81582453f4c4eadc90d2e700d
address
ltc1qmuylsas85w96s9vzg5l5cn4deyxjuuqdfhvl0p
transaction
59af8c7d5569b44772048832b4373a3eb9847b9d133207fc15f690cf3b4bc36a
spent
true